Alga extract mix

Scientific name: Algae Extract
Classification: Active Ingredients of Plant Origin.

Revitalizing, remineralizing, stimulating, humectant.

Tales from Nature

For centuries, Algae have been used in beauty rituals in different cultures due to their moisturizing power and rich composition, which includes proteins, vitamins and lipids.

Algae Extracts are still considered valuable in the world of cosmetics because they are multifunctional, thanks to the valuable substances and minerals within them, which attribute revitalizing and remineralizing, stimulating and humectant properties to them.

Skin Benefits

This valuable combination of marine extracts is a mainstay of functional cosmetics because of its restructuring virtues and high affinity to biological tissues.

  • Moisturization and softness: the hygroscopic properties allow moisture to be retained in the layers of the skin, leaving it smooth and soft.

  • Regenerating action: exert a regulatory effect on cellular metabolism, promoting natural skin renewal.

  • Purifying and detoxifying: they support the removal of toxins and waste, being essential for sebaceous balance and pore cleansing.

  • Humectant relief: they act effectively in products such as toners and peels to preserve freshness and well-being.

  • Mineral supply: they remineralize tissues, imparting firmness and tone to the scalp.

Hair Benefits.

  • Deep restructuring: the presence of proteins allows repairing the hair fiber and fortifying the stem from its internal structure.

  • Protection from oxidation: they shield the hair from free radicals, preserving the hair structure and its natural youthfulness.

  • Elasticity and vigor: they significantly improve the quality of the hair, making it strong, shiny and vital.
